服务器预装环境选什么
-
在选择服务器预装环境时,需要考虑多个因素。下面是几个常见的服务器预装环境选项以及它们的特点和适用场景:
-
Linux(例如Ubuntu、CentOS):Linux是一个开源的操作系统,具有高度的稳定性和安全性。它广泛用于Web服务器、数据库服务器等领域,适用于对系统性能和安全性要求较高的场景。
-
Windows Server:Windows Server是微软开发的服务器操作系统,适用于运行Windows平台上的应用程序。它具有强大的图形界面和易用性,适合不熟悉Linux操作系统的管理员。
-
LAMP(Linux、Apache、MySQL、PHP):LAMP是一种经典的服务器预装环境,适用于搭建Web应用程序的服务器。Linux作为操作系统,Apache作为Web服务器,MySQL作为数据库系统,PHP作为服务器端脚本语言。
-
LNMP(Linux、Nginx、MySQL、PHP):LNMP是一种类似于LAMP的服务器预装环境,但使用的是Nginx作为Web服务器。相比于Apache,Nginx具有更高的性能和并发处理能力,适合高并发访问的Web应用。
-
MEAN(MongoDB、Express.js、AngularJS、Node.js):MEAN是一种使用JavaScript全栈技术搭建Web应用程序的服务器预装环境。MongoDB作为NoSQL数据库,Express.js作为服务器端框架,AngularJS作为前端框架,Node.js作为服务器端JavaScript运行时。
要选择合适的服务器预装环境,需要根据自身业务需求和技术栈来决定。如果你的应用程序需要运行特定的操作系统或平台,可以选择相应的服务器预装环境。同时,还要考虑服务器的性能需求、对安全性的要求以及对特定技术栈的依赖等因素。
1年前 -
-
选择服务器预装环境时,有几个关键的因素需要考虑。以下是选择服务器预装环境时需要考虑的几个重要因素:
-
应用程序需求:服务器预装环境应该能够满足应用程序的需求。例如,如果您的应用程序是基于某种特定的编程语言或框架开发的,那么您需要选择支持该语言或框架的服务器预装环境。
-
安全性:服务器预装环境应该具备一定的安全性能,能够提供防火墙、加密等安全功能。服务器预装环境还应该能够定期更新和修补系统漏洞,以确保服务器和应用程序的安全性。
-
灵活性:服务器预装环境应该具备一定的灵活性,能够适应不同类型和规模的应用程序。它应该支持扩展和定制,以满足不同应用程序的需求。
-
性能:服务器预装环境应该能够提供良好的性能,以确保应用程序能够高效地运行。这包括处理器、内存、存储和网络等硬件资源的优化,以及有效的资源管理和负载均衡。
-
技术支持:服务器预装环境应该提供技术支持服务,以帮助您在使用过程中遇到的问题。这包括提供文档、论坛、在线聊天和电话支持等多种渠道,以及良好的响应时间和问题解决能力。
总而言之,选择服务器预装环境时,应该考虑应用程序需求、安全性、灵活性、性能和技术支持等因素。根据这些因素,选择适合您的应用程序和业务需求的服务器预装环境。
1年前 -
-
选择服务器预装环境是一个关键的决策,因为它将直接影响到服务器的性能、稳定性和安全性。 在选择服务器预装环境时,需要考虑以下几个因素:
-
操作系统:选择一个可靠、稳定且功能强大的操作系统是非常重要的。常见的服务器操作系统包括Linux、Windows Server等。Linux 是最常用的服务器操作系统,它具有高度的可定制性和稳定性,适用于大多数服务器应用。Windows Server 是微软公司开发的服务器操作系统,适用于Windows平台的应用程序。
-
Web 服务器:选择一个适合你的应用程序的Web服务器是非常重要的。常用的Web服务器包括Apache、Nginx、IIS等。 Apache是最受欢迎的开源Web服务器,稳定性好,可适应大多数应用场景。Nginx是一个高性能的Web服务器和反向代理服务器,适用于高并发、大负载的场景。IIS是Windows Server自带的Web服务器,适用于Windows平台的应用程序。
-
数据库服务器:选择一个可靠且高性能的数据库服务器对于存储和访问数据非常重要。常用的数据库服务器包括MySQL、PostgreSQL、Microsoft SQL Server等。MySQL是最常用、最流行的开源关系型数据库,适用于大多数Web应用。PostgreSQL也是一个开源关系型数据库,具有高度的可扩展性和安全性。Microsoft SQL Server是微软公司的关系型数据库管理系统,适用于Windows平台的应用程序。
-
脚本语言和框架:选择一个适合你的应用程序的脚本语言和框架是非常重要的。常用的脚本语言包括PHP、Python、Ruby等。常用的框架包括Laravel、Django、Ruby on Rails等。选择一个熟悉和适合你技术团队的脚本语言和框架将有助于开发高效和稳定的应用程序。
在选择服务器预装环境时,还应该考虑到维护和更新的便利性、安全性的要求以及是否需要额外安装和配置其他组件和软件。
最后,建议在选择服务器预装环境时,可以参考其他类似应用的部署经验,咨询专业人士的建议,以及自己的技术要求和限制,选择一个最合适的服务器预装环境。
1年前 -